One of the best ways to improve your technical analysis is by combining multiple indicators to confirm signals. No single indicator is perfect — each has strengths and weaknesses. The trick lies in blending them intelligently to minimize false signals.

For instance, if the Moving Average shows an uptrend while the RSI indicates oversold conditions, that’s a strong buy signal. Similarly, when MACD crosses below the signal line in a downtrend, it confirms bearish momentum.

The best traders use indicators for confirmation, not prediction. A good rule is to pair a trend-following tool (like MA) with a momentum or oscillator tool (like RSI or Stochastic). This combination helps you read both trend direction and strength.
Always backtest your indicator strategy on historical data before applying it live. Simplicity and consistency lead to long-term profitability in Forex.
